Americas programs

Automotive, agricultural, energy and medical device buyers in the Americas often need a mix of rapid technical clarification and strong documentation. Trelleborg conversations in this region commonly focus on silicone tubing, rubber hose replacement, EPDM seals, molded rubber products and polymer components that must fit existing equipment while satisfying plant reliability teams. The practical challenge is to keep sourcing speed from hiding risk. Buyers may need help comparing domestic replenishment, cross-border packaging requirements, FDA-related questions, RoHS declarations for equipment or change-control expectations for qualified OEM parts.

European programs

European applications frequently place regulatory evidence near the beginning of the purchase journey. REACH SVHC updates, RoHS, customer restricted substance lists and sustainability goals can shape material choice as much as mechanical performance. Trelleborg industry support in Europe is therefore organized around disciplined requirement capture. For rubber seals, O-rings, industrial hoses and plastic processing parts, buyers can align compound chemistry, recyclability questions, supplier documentation and qualification windows before a part moves into validation. This prevents the familiar problem of a sample that works mechanically but stalls because the paperwork cannot support the destination market.

Asia-Pacific programs

Asia-Pacific buyers often balance high-volume manufacturing, fast tooling decisions and local plant support across several countries. Trelleborg application mapping helps teams separate commodity-like purchasing from engineered requirements that deserve deeper review. Silicone tubing, molded rubber gaskets, industrial hose assemblies and polymer components may need different packaging, labeling, inspection and supply approaches depending on the plant. The goal is to preserve repeatability as volumes grow, especially when sourcing teams must coordinate headquarters standards with regional production realities and launch dates.
